What is the difference between It Automation Python vs Network Automation Engineer?

AspectIt Automation PythonNetwork Automation Engineer
Required SkillsPython scripting, automation tools, scripting languagesNetwork protocols, scripting, network devices
CertificationsPython certifications, automation tools certificationsCCNA, CCNP, network-specific certifications
Work EnvironmentIT departments, automation teams, software environmentsNetwork operations centers, telecom companies
Industry UsageIT services, software development, automation projectsNetworking, telecommunications, infrastructure management

While both roles involve scripting and automation, It Automation Python focuses on automating IT processes using Python across various systems, whereas Network Automation Engineer specializes in automating network configurations and management using scripting and network-specific tools.

What is IT Automation with Python?

IT Automation with Python refers to using the Python programming language to automate repetitive IT tasks such as system administration, network management, software deployment, and data processing. Python is widely used in the IT industry because of its simplicity, versatility, and a large number of libraries that support automation. Tasks like managing servers, monitoring systems, handling backups, and orchestrating workflows can be efficiently automated using Python scripts, saving time and reducing human error. Learning IT automation with Python can significantly improve productivity and scalability in IT operations.

What are some common challenges faced by IT Automation Engineers working with Python, and how can they be addressed?

IT Automation Engineers using Python often encounter challenges such as integrating with diverse systems, handling legacy infrastructure, and ensuring scripts remain maintainable as automation needs grow. To address these issues, it's important to write modular, well-documented code and leverage popular automation frameworks like Ansible or SaltStack that support Python. Regular code reviews and collaboration with system administrators and DevOps teams can help identify potential bottlenecks early, ensuring smoother deployments and long-term scalability.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an IT Automation Python Engineer, and why are they important?

To excel as an IT Automation Python Engineer, you need strong proficiency in Python programming, knowledge of automation frameworks, and a solid understanding of networking and systems administration, often supported by a degree in computer science or related certifications. Familiarity with tools like Ansible, Jenkins, Docker, and cloud platforms such as AWS or Azure is commonly required. Probl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ication are vital soft skills in this role. These competencies are crucial for designing reliable automation solutions that enhance operational efficiency and minimize manual errors in IT environments.
